Danville author and political reporter Mark Curtis has won a 2010 International Book Award for The Making of the President 2008, Age of Obama: A Reporter’s Journey with Clinton, McCain and Obama. His book received first place in the Current Events/Political-Social category. The book is available in print or Kindle from http://www.amazon.com/.
